腾讯云
开发者社区
文档
建议反馈
控制台
登录/注册
首页
学习
活动
专区
工具
TVP
最新优惠活动
文章/答案/技术大牛
搜索
搜索
关闭
发布
精选内容/技术社群/优惠产品,
尽在小程序
立即前往
文章
问答
(9999+)
视频
沙龙
1
回答
React
createContext
/
useContext
无法
在
页面
之间
存活
、
我正在尝试为应用程序需要的所有组件创建一个共享的全局状态,而不是依赖于道具钻取或redux,我正在尝试通过
React
上下文来实现这一点。 当我
在
路由
之间
切换时,为什么我的用户上下文不能继续存在?我是否需要将任何其他挂钩与
useContext
结合使用 //index.jsimport ReactDOM from '
react
-dom'; import, {
浏览 12
提问于2019-06-15
得票数 6
回答已采纳
2
回答
TypeScript on
useContext
、
、
、
我正在关注youtube上的一篇反应教程,在那里我试图将项目从JavaScript转换成TypeScript,我
在
useContext
上遇到了很多麻烦,如果有人能在这里帮助我,我会很感激的。如果您想知道这里的哪个教程是
浏览 11
提问于2022-10-23
得票数 -1
回答已采纳
1
回答
在
React
组件
之间
传递Socket.io对象
、
、
我正在尝试
在
我的
React
应用程序中实现实时聊天。这是我第一次使用socket.io,我遇到了一些麻烦。我
在
App.js中创建了一个新的套接字和连接,如下所示: const [socket, setSocket] = useState(null); const setupSocket = ()classes.button} variant="contained" color="primary"> Join </Button> 当我尝试访问Chat.js中的套接字时
浏览 46
提问于2021-04-27
得票数 0
1
回答
在
ionic
react
中的两个选项卡
之间
共享数据
、
如何在一个地方声明它,以便能够
在
两个选项卡
之间
共享它。我不认为将其作为参数
在
选项卡
之间
传递是一个好的解决方案。
在
ionic angular中,我使用了一个服务来处理这种变量,并且很容易
在
整个应用程序中引用这些变量。离子反应的解决方案是什么?
浏览 31
提问于2021-03-27
得票数 0
2
回答
是否未从提供程序传递
React
useContext
值?
、
我尝试使用
useContext
向下传递一个值,如下所示export const selectedContext =
React
.
createContext
(); <Cards /> </selectedContext.Provider>};这是
在
Card.js中(提供者中的子级) co
浏览 15
提问于2020-03-01
得票数 0
2
回答
要在每个
页面
中显示的通知组件存储在哪里?反应自定义通知
我需要在每个路由中都是可见的,例如,如果我想改变路由,使其
在
不同的路由中可见,那么将这个组件放在哪里? 现在,这是内部主页,并将触发在某些情况下。工作很好,但在什么时候。转到不同的
页面
是不可见的。将此组件设置为
在
每个
页面
中可见的位置?
浏览 7
提问于2022-05-04
得票数 0
1
回答
React
Context未更新值以传递到另一个
页面
、
、
我正在用Nextjs创建一个电子商务应用程序,并希望
在
页面
之间
共享数据。我知道我们不能使用props
在
页面
之间
传递数据,所以我正在研究
react
context api。这是我第一次使用
react
上下文api。我研究了一下,发现应该在nextjs的_app.js
页面
中添加提供者。但这会在所有
页面
之间
共享数据。另外,我的数据是由getStaticProps
在
应用程序的slug
浏览 8
提问于2021-05-25
得票数 0
回答已采纳
1
回答
React
.js -使用Context API
在
组件
之间
传递函数-不起作用
我试图
在
两个组件
之间
传递一个函数,但即使我没有任何错误,我传递的函数也不会显示,或者更准确地说,它不工作。我有两个文件,其中一个是创建上下文,而另一个是使用它(显然)。现在,它们不会显示
在
App.js (以index.js格式呈现,通常的东西)中,它们
在
单独的文件夹中。我正在使用
React
Router显示其中一个
页面
(News.js)。以下是这些文件:import
React
, {
useContext
,
cr
浏览 51
提问于2021-03-02
得票数 0
回答已采纳
1
回答
无法
在
页面
刷新时读取未定义的
react
路由器的属性
、
、
、
我正在使用Edamam recipe做一个菜谱应用程序,
在
我刷新recipe Detail page.when之前,它工作得很好。read properties of undefined (reading 'recipe') 我不知道为什么当
页面
没有刷新时,happening.It会工作。,{
useContext
,useState,useEffect} from "
react
"; import { Link } from "
react
-router-dom
浏览 13
提问于2021-11-21
得票数 0
1
回答
React
Native中的
useContext
、
我一直
在
尝试使用
React
Native中的上下文钩子,但它似乎不起作用,它返回未定义。但是,当我使用<Context.Consumer>时,它确实工作得很好,你知道
useContext
在
React
Native中是否受支持吗?
浏览 69
提问于2019-09-23
得票数 4
回答已采纳
1
回答
未定义
React
上下文
我一直
无法
在
我的
React
应用程序中正确使用上下文。大多数文档都使用基于类的组件,我正在尝试使用功能组件。 该错误说明未定义AppContext。如果我
在
<AppContext.Provider value='AppName'>之后立即添加console.log(
React
.
useContext
(AppContext)),则会记录正确答案。但是,这里没有
在
Header中定义AppContext: const app =
useCo
浏览 18
提问于2021-02-11
得票数 0
回答已采纳
4
回答
未定义
React
上下文
、
NavContext.jsNav.jsimport NavCon
浏览 8
提问于2021-01-21
得票数 1
回答已采纳
1
回答
不使用嵌套组件的
useContext
、
、
我试图重构一个应用程序使用
useContext
,但遇到了一个障碍,
无法
弄清楚发生了什么。我拥有
在
_app.js中设置的全局上下文,并将其传递给呈现它的Layout。这很好,我
在
pages/_app.js中定义的pages/_app.js上下文变量
在
Layout上
浏览 1
提问于2021-08-07
得票数 0
1
回答
如何使用useParams
在
createContext
钩子中的数据
在
功能组件中反应js
、
我希望
在
useParams()内部传递
createContext
()的数据,以便在不同的组件中使用数据import
React
,{
createContext
} from '
react
';import {useParams} from '
react
-router-dom'; } expor
浏览 1
提问于2022-08-19
得票数 0
1
回答
子组件
无法
访问通过上下文挂钩传递的函数
、
、
、
我
在
使用
react
上下文钩子API时遇到了问题,我通过提供程序传递了这个函数,但是子组件似乎
无法
运行它。// import ".import {
createContext
} from "
react
"; export constThemeUpdateContext =
createContext</e
浏览 1
提问于2021-04-15
得票数 0
1
回答
当对初始值使用null时,`
React
.
createContext
(Null)的类型
、
、
、
、
我有一个钩子,用于从
useContext
中获取值import
React
, {
useContext
} from '
react
'; const firebase =
useContext
FirebaseConte
浏览 15
提问于2020-08-14
得票数 0
1
回答
如何在NextJS组件
之间
共享状态
、
、
我想在Next.js中的
页面
之间
传递一个状态。, useState } from '
react
'; {children} );
在
我的
浏览 6
提问于2022-03-26
得票数 0
回答已采纳
2
回答
如何在单独安装的组件树
之间
共享
React
上下文状态
、
我知道
React
Context对于
在
深层组件树中共享状态非常有用,而不必进行属性钻取。但是,我找不到一种好方法来
在
多个独立的组件树
之间
共享相同的上下文值。我工作的应用程序并不是一个真正的
React
前端;相反,它有一些
React
树散布
在
整个
页面
上。我想使用上下文
在
它们
之间
共享状态。我知道Redux可以处理这个问题,但如果可能,我会尽量避免使用它。// counter-context.jsx imp
浏览 2
提问于2019-09-10
得票数 9
1
回答
试着做出反应中的
useContext
、
、
我试图
在
react
中使用
useContext
,我
在
向提供者发送值时遇到了问题,但是
在
useContext
中,我
无法
得到这个值。
在
父“索引”中创建
createContext
export default functionfunction NavBar(props) { con
浏览 5
提问于2022-04-05
得票数 0
2
回答
将函数导出为默认值,同时为
在
同一类中使用而对其进行析构
、
、
我正在使用,下面是一个示例 const FooContext =
createContext
我知道
createContext
函数具有可用的{ Provider, Consumer }析构属性。有什么方法可以用来压缩这段代码吗?我有这样的想法,但不幸的是,这不是有效的语法。import
React
, {
createContext
, use
浏览 4
提问于2020-05-21
得票数 1
回答已采纳
点击加载更多
扫码
添加站长 进交流群
领取专属
10元无门槛券
手把手带您无忧上云
相关
资讯
前端:从状态管理到有限状态机的思考
【一文看懂】React中usestate与useRef的区别与联系
想创建应用程序,只用React Hooks就够了
React的基本用法和技术特点
从源码中来,到业务中去,React性能优化终极指南
热门
标签
更多标签
云服务器
ICP备案
云直播
对象存储
腾讯会议
活动推荐
运营活动
广告
关闭
领券